NC wins chair, UML vice-chair in Kamal rural municipality



DAMAK: Nepali Congress (NC) candidate Hukum Singh Rai has registered his win for the post of chairperson in the Kamal rural municipality of Jhapa.

e secured 12,868 votes while his close contender CPN-UML’s candidate Bhim Rai gathered 9,653 votes.

Newly-elected Singh was defeated by immediate past Chairperson of the rural municipality Menuka Kafle in the earlier round of the local election on a lottery basis.

According to the Kamal-based Office of the Election Officer, UML candidate Prameela Neupane Tiwari secured 10,845 votes to emerge winner as the vice-chairperson.

Her close contender Parshuram Subedi of CPN (Maoist Centre) got 8,371 votes.
